I like the way you filled the frame on this one. Even the fiber on the rope is visible. What iso setting did you use? I think a shot in all available ones, then choosing the least noisy one would have improved it. Also when you take several shots of the same subject, use a tripod so you don't change the composition you've chosen.

Really looks oversharpened to me (or was shot at too high contrast adjustment.) White haloing around everything hurts the inherent value in the excellent composition of this shot. Soft does not always equal bad. Just should have let this image stand on its own merits before USM was introduced. 6.
